Synopsis: THE ART OF GETTING WELL is written to inspire and help people who are overcoming illness and want to improve their quality of life. Far more than just another list of recommended behaviours and attitudes, it explains how to change the very things in your life that contribute to illness and rob you of motivation in the face of a chronic condition. The heart of this book is its passionate, powerful message of how you can overcome barriers to self-care, especially the lack of support, damaged self-esteem, loss of hope and socio-economic difficulties that prevent people from getting well. Spero suggests ideas and techniques seldom found elsewhere, such as living with rhythm, the intelligence of the body and the role of creativity in recovery. The book is written in a conversational, upbeat style and includes interviews and first-person accounts of recovery that will give readers encouragement and hope. This is a unique guide to an important art we seldom think about - the art of embracing health, the art of really getting well.
